Problems solved by technology

The traditional reinforcement cage can bend its tip before binding, and then bind the stirrups. However, the reinforcement cage of the existing prefabricated high-strength concrete square pile is formed by automatic rolling welding, and the pile tip can only be placed between the hoops. The bending can only be carried out after the seam welding is completed. If manual bending is used, it is not only time-consuming and laborious, but also the bending size and bending angle are difficult to control, and it is easy to damage the steel cage that has been seamed.
[0003] In addition, the existing steel cage bending machine can only bend a square steel cage of a specific size. When the side length of the steel cage changes, the existing steel cage bending machine cannot make corresponding changes. That is, it is not possible to switch between reinforcement cages of different sizes, and the scope of application is small

Abstract

The invention discloses a pile tip bending machine for prefabricated pile reinforcing cages of different sizes. The pile tip bending machine comprises a rack, wherein the rack comprises a base and vertical supporting plates which are arranged on the base, the vertical supporting plates comprise the first vertical supporting plate and the second vertical supporting plate which are arranged in a front-back mode and parallel with each other, a driving portion and a reinforcing steel bar guiding and positioning mechanism are installed between the first vertical supporting plate and the second vertical supporting plate, the reinforcing steel bar guiding and positioning mechanism comprises an adjustable blocking portion and a plurality of sets of reinforcing steel bar limiting portions which are matched with the adjustable blocking portion, the sizes of the reinforcing cages corresponding to the different sets of the reinforcing steel bar limiting portions are different, a pile tip limiting mechanism is arranged on the base, the base comprises two parallel transverse plates and two parallel sliding tracks which are arranged between the two transverse plates, and the vertical supporting plates can slide along the sliding tracks. By the aid of the pile tip bending machine, the reinforcing cages of the different sizes can be bent, and the pile tip bending machine is simple to operate and high in stability.

Description

technical field [0001] The invention relates to a steel bar bending machine, in particular to a pile tip bending machine used for reinforcing cages of prefabricated piles of different sizes. Background technique [0002] Prefabricated concrete piles can be divided into two categories: prefabricated reinforced concrete piles and prestressed concrete piles according to the type of main reinforcement and the corresponding production process. Among them, prefabricated reinforced concrete piles are formed by densely binding stirrups and hooping main reinforcements to pre-fabricate reinforcement cages, and after adjustment, inspection, and mold closing, concrete is poured, covered, and maintained. The traditional reinforcement cage can bend its tip before binding, and then bind the stirrups.
